#ifndef FOUNDATION_ACE_FRAMEWORKS_CORE_ANIMATION_ANIMATION_H
#define FOUNDATION_ACE_FRAMEWORKS_CORE_ANIMATION_ANIMATION_H

#include "base/utils/listener.h"
#include "core/animation/curve.h"
#include "core/animation/interpolator.h"

namespace OHOS::Ace {

template<typename T>
class ACE_FORCE_EXPORT Animation : public Interpolator, public ValueListenable<T> {
    DECLARE_ACE_TYPE(Animation, Interpolator);

public:
    virtual const T& GetValue() const = 0;

    void OnInitNotify(float normalizedTime, bool reverse) override
    {
        // If the user sets the initial value, the animation stay at the initial value.
        if (inited_) {
            ValueListenable<T>::NotifyListener(initValue_);
        } else {
            OnNormalizedTimestampChanged(normalizedTime, reverse);
        }
    }

    void SetInitValue(const T& initValue)
    {
        initValue_ = initValue;
        inited_ = true;
    }

    bool HasInitValue() const
    {
        return inited_;
    }

    virtual void SetCurve(const RefPtr<Curve>& curve) {}

private:
    T initValue_ {};
    bool inited_ = false;
};

} // namespace OHOS::Ace

#endif // FOUNDATION_ACE_FRAMEWORKS_CORE_ANIMATION_ANIMATION_H
